After a few niggles with the rig and heavy rains that delayed us a couple of weeks, Paulo and the team are getting excited that we have hooked into the same super high-grade Nilsson’s reef which gave Troy Resources so much success between 2003-6. Back then Troy pulled out 260,000 ounces at an average open pit grade of 29 g/t Au and earnt them a $400m market capitalisation when gold was < $600 an ounce. These days a 5 g/t open pit is regarded as world class and we suspect 29 will take some beating going forward.  

A second drill rig has arrived and we have asked Helio to secure a third rig for May. Once drilling is complete at MLSE, we are also debating whether to move those 2 drill rigs to Sertão as this deposit deserves a much bigger programme given the scale of the opportunity for a multi-million ounce high grade target.

As you may recall, Paulo and the team hit 0.5m @ 218 g/t Au just before Christmas. The 40, 80 and 120 metre step-outs to the west appear to suggest a continuation of this super high-grade mineralisation. This supports Pilar Gold’s plan to start underground mining at Sertão by the end of the year at an estimated average diluted grade of 30 g/t Au which could make it one of the highest grading gold mines in the world.

Sertão will be a game changer for our Pilar mill that has been on a staple diet of 1.2 g/t Au feed from our Pilar and MLZ mines for the last couple of years. Blending Sertão's super high-grade lush ore will be just the tonic to double our daily ounces to 260 with just 7 deliveries a day from Sertão. This compares with the 150 deliveries we are making from Pilar and MLZ to the mill at the moment. Once Israel Oliveira and his mining team get their eye in, there is no reason we can't increase that to 10 or 15 trucks from Sertão.  

As a good luck omen we are very proud that Francisco Barbosa joined the team in October last year. Francisco was Ken Nilsson’s right hand man at the Sertão mill when it was operating and will help oversee the introduction of Sertão feed into the Pilar mill.
